I received a small jar of the Deodorant Creme, it smells great!  The package also came with a little informative instruction sheet.  I learned a lot from that sheet of paper.  For example, it is recommended that you exfoliate your arm pits!  Why?  Well, apparently your pits go through a detoxing period which is helped along by the exfoliating. The detoxing process is said to take anywhere from 4-15 days.   I used a salt scrub for my exfoliating, but you can use a loofa or dry brush.  

I don't particularly like putting deodorant on with my fingers, but it wasn't greasy and came off easily after application.  In my opinion the Bella Organics Natural Deodorant works well.  I didn't think I smelled bad at all and I kept sniffing myself (I'm not ashamed.)  They offer other scents as well as the Vanilla Mint.  If you are new to chemical free deodorant, or have been using it, I would recommend giving this brand a try!  Plus you have the chance to win one now!  Enter the giveaway below!
